The performance began with melodious singing. JIAO Miao, Artistic Mentor of the Arts Festival and Chorus Master of the China NCPA Orchestra, guided the teachers and students through an immersive arts journey with her professional and engaging interpretations.
In the first half, the Changping District Second Experiment Primary School Choir sang Chinese ethnic minority songs including Wai-Sa-Lo and Qiduolie, as well as new songs written on the basis of classical poetry and modern music, such as Minor Odes of the Kingdom·Deer’s Call. The performances were enriched by dance and theatrical elements.

The second half unfolded in four themes. The Haidian District Experimental Primary School Golden Sail Choir gave a scintillating rendition of The Most Beautiful Starlight, A Journey in Search of Sounds, Naughty Children’s Declaration and other songs. A highlight came when Chorus Master JIAO Miao not only shared insights on choral art but also raised her baton over the two choirs in performing Sing A Mountain Song for the Party.

During the rehearsals for the Arts Festival, the young choral performers recorded a short video entitled “Theatre Etiquette Initiative”, transforming into little ambassadors of promoting theatre etiquettes.
Standing on a higher dimension as a stronger trendsetter with greater social influence, this year’s NCPA Youth Arts Festival is designed to combine aesthetic education with moral education, fuse high-quality arts resources with basic education and foster collaboration among society, government and schools on aesthetic education.
This year’s Arts Festival embodies the core idea of equity, diversity and excellence:
Equity: ensuring balanced participation from urban and suburban areas, while partnering with the Golden Sail Art Troupe and other art organisations to share art resources.
Diversity: featuring six genres of art - chorus, symphony, folk music, traditional opera, drama and dance, while exploring cross-disciplinary innovations with sports, science and technology to stimulate young people’s interest in the arts.
Excellence: guided by artistic directors LÜ Jia, WU Lingfen, HU Wenge and LIU Sha, with support from the China NCPA Orchestra and Chorus, NCPA Resident Singers and NCPA Drama Ensemble, offering teachers and students wonderful artistic experiences.
